Output 905694a076a00172d4ca6e33e106bb7e313355e981c115def1a28844fe4dd54f:0

value
16323865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 490af8a1c775e530f6985e20f0e93312c30e0c53 OP_EQUAL
address
MEZNhj9MUaZYH4c14Gh7wssBC35wTXtmuw
transaction
905694a076a00172d4ca6e33e106bb7e313355e981c115def1a28844fe4dd54f
spent
true